PhonePe Crossed 600 Million (60 Crore) Registered Users in March 2025

A Milestone for Digital Payments in India

India’s digital payments revolution has been marked by several milestones, but PhonePe crossing 600 million users is one of the most significant. This achievement cements PhonePe’s position as a leader in India’s fintech landscape and reflects the country’s massive adoption of digital transactions.

What’s even more impressive is that this growth wasn’t just a result of the company’s early entry into the market. It’s a reflection of how PhonePe has managed to evolve, innovate, and continuously adapt to meet the diverse needs of Indian consumers.

How PhonePe Achieved the 600 Million Mark

PhonePe’s growth to 600 million registered users is a tale of rapid scaling, market penetration and diversification. Since its launch, PhonePe has built a robust infrastructure that offers more than just simple peer-to-peer transfers. The platform now covers bill payments, mobile recharges, insurance, investments, e-commerce payments, and even gold purchases.

The diversity of its services has been key to its success. By focusing on both urban and rural India, PhonePe made itself accessible to everyone, not just tech-savvy users. The integration of UPI (Unified Payments Interface) into its app also allowed it to capture a significant share of the market, enabling users to make seamless and quick payments across the board.

This versatility and inclusive approach have allowed PhonePe’s 600 million users to grow exponentially, serving a wide demographic of consumers who see the app as a daily utility.

The Power of UPI and PhonePe’s Strategic Growth

A major driver of PhonePe’s 600 million users is UPI’s widespread adoption. Launched by the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I), UPI has made digital transactions more accessible and affordable for millions. PhonePe was one of the first apps to leverage UPI, and that early mover advantage allowed it to build a loyal user base.

Moreover, UPI’s real-time payments system, which allows for immediate money transfers, has become a game-changer in the digital payments space. PhonePe’s continuous integration of UPI-based features into its app, such as bill payments, merchant payments, and even P2P transfers, has kept it ahead of the competition.

What This Means for India’s Digital Payment Ecosystem

PhonePe’s milestone isn’t just an achievement for the company; it signals a larger trend in the Indian market. The 600 million users milestone demonstrates how deeply digital payments have integrated into daily life, particularly in the wake of demonetisation and the pandemic, which pushed India toward a cashless economy.

The growth of apps like PhonePe also highlights how Indian consumers are ready for more complex fintech services such as micro-loans, insurance, and wealth management, all of which are becoming key offerings on the PhonePe platform.
